		<description>Awareness is good! Thanks for posting. They turned the petition in, and the good news is the legislature gave the schools some money so the cuts were minimized, at least. Now, we&#039;re preparing for the tough conversation of what to do for the next two years with the budget shortfall. 
(I get a bit wonkish here:) If only we&#039;d been saving all our unexpected windfalls of taxes instead of sending them back to taxpayers -- we&#039;d have a fund that could significantly protect from cuts. $1.2 billion was kicked back from the 07 income taxes, and the overall revenue shortfall is currently being estimated at $3billion, so it would have made a HUGE difference.
